Understanding the Cost of Installing Solar Panels: A Comprehensive Guide

The cost of installing solar panels can vary significantly based on several factors. This guide aims to break down these costs and provide a clearer understanding of what you might expect when considering solar energy for your home.

Factors Influencing the Cost

Size of the Solar Panel System

The size of the system is a primary factor in determining the cost. Larger systems that produce more energy will naturally be more expensive than smaller systems. However, larger systems might offer better economies of scale.

Type of Solar Panels

There are different types of solar panels, such as monocrystalline, polycrystalline, and thin-film. Monocrystalline panels are generally more efficient and thus more expensive, while thin-film panels are cheaper but less efficient.

Installation Costs

Installation costs can vary based on location and complexity of the installation. For example, a rooftop installation may cost more due to additional labor and equipment required.

Financial Incentives

Federal and State Tax Credits

The federal government offers tax credits for solar installations, which can significantly reduce the overall cost. Additionally, many states provide further incentives to encourage solar energy use.

Solar Rebates

Some utility companies offer rebates to customers who install solar panels. These rebates can help offset the initial installation costs and make solar energy more affordable.

Net Metering

Net metering allows you to sell excess energy back to the grid, providing a financial return on your investment. This can be a significant factor in the overall cost-benefit analysis of solar panel installation.

Breaking Down the Costs

  • Initial Equipment Cost: This includes the price of the panels, inverters, and mounting equipment.
  • Installation Labor: Professional installation ensures safety and efficiency but comes at a cost.
  • Permits and Inspections: Necessary for legal compliance and safety assurance.
  • Maintenance: While minimal, ongoing maintenance costs should be considered.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average cost of installing solar panels?

The average cost can range from $15,000 to $25,000 before any incentives or rebates. The final cost depends on the size of the system and location-specific factors.

How long does it take to recoup the investment?

Typically, it takes between 5 to 10 years to recoup the investment through energy savings and incentives. This period can vary based on local energy costs and the efficiency of the solar panel system.

Are there financing options available?

Yes, many companies offer financing options such as solar loans or leases, which can help spread the cost over time and make solar panels more accessible.
